The Bank of America 500 is a NASCAR Sprint Cup Series race that is hosted annually at Charlotte Motor Speedway in Concord, North Carolina, United States, with the other one being the Coca-Cola 600 on Memorial Day weekend, the 600-mile race. The race is held in the middle of October, as part of the Chase for the Sprint Cup and it is a 500-mile annual race, Prior to 1966, the race was a 400-mile event.
